The Verdict: Which is Better?
When placing Boneless Skinless Breasts and Beef Franks side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.
For calorie-conscious consumers, Boneless Skinless Breasts is the clear winner. With 43 fewer calories per 100g than its competitor, it allows for more volume while keeping your energy intake in check.
In terms of sugar control, Boneless Skinless Breasts takes the lead with only 0g of sugar per 100g, whereas Beef Franks contains 1.77g. Lower sugar content is often linked to better metabolic health.
Looking to build muscle? Boneless Skinless Breasts offers a protein boost with 23.2g per 100g, outperforming Beef Franks in this category.
